### Step 4: Migrate the Proctoring Queue

In this step you move the ExamGate proctoring queue from the legacy broker to the new persistent store. First, drain in-flight sessions by setting the intake flag to `paused` and waiting until the active-session counter reaches zero—this can take up to twenty minutes during exam windows. Then export the pending queue with the `examgate export-queue` command. Once the export completes, run the import job against the new queue database, which you reach with the connection string below.

replica DSN, kajep-yahag: mssql://praok_svc:iF@db-8d68.plorvaio.local:5432/eliion

On-call: relevance tuning for Querra lives in the ranker-notes space. Changes to boost weights ship nightly; if CTR drops >5%, roll back the last weights bundle via the Querra console. Synonym maps are owned by the Lexfield team — don't edit directly. Tuning notes archive requires the sealed recovery account. To unlock that account, use the passphrase below.

vault phrase of bagaf-kajeg = jorath-feniel-briir-siliel-ralix

// REINDEX_BATCH_CAP limits docs per shard pass in the Tallowfield
// nightly search reindex. Raising it starves the ingest queue;
// lowering it overruns the maintenance window. 5000 is the tested
// sweet spot. Change only with a soak run. Verified against the
// build noted below.

session token of bawif-hahog = htk6_ac5981

Ticket: DeployBot env misconfig on Harrowgate staging.

The deploy-status chat bot posts to the wrong room because staging copied prod's channel map. Reviewer: check the diff only touches the staging overlay. Channel routing is fixed in this patch; bot auth was never set at all, which is why it silently dropped messages. The bot's messaging credential goes on the line below.

secret setting of kajep-tagep: VAULT_KEY5=e66ae